How Old Fig Garden’s Tree Canopy Changes the Battery Equation

Here’s what you won’t hear from an out-of-town installer working from a satellite image. The fig, oak, and ornamental trees planted throughout Old Fig Garden in the 1920s through 1940s are not just landscaping. They are a permanent shadow on your roof for several hours every day. A mature fig tree over a south-facing roof can cut panel output by 40% or more during the exact hours when panels are supposed to do their heaviest lifting.

This changes what a battery is actually for in Old Fig Garden. In a treeless new Fresno subdivision, a battery is mostly a backup device: panels fill it during the day, the house draws from it at night. But in 93704, the battery often has a second job. It time-shifts whatever limited afternoon sun actually reaches your roof into PG&E’s highest-priced evening window, from 4 to 9 p.m. On a shaded Spanish Colonial Revival estate near North Van Ness Boulevard, our crew retrofitted a Tesla Powerwall 3 onto an existing array partially blocked by a century-old fig tree. We upgraded the original 100-amp service panel to 200 amps, added DC optimizers to keep the shade from dragging down the whole string, and programmed the battery to discharge during that 4-9 p.m. peak. The roof only offsets about 60% of the home’s usage, but the battery pushes the annual true-up statement to roughly 90% covered. That’s the kind of math you only get when someone looks at your actual roof and your actual bill, not a zip-code average.

This is the core of our Solar Battery Storage & Backup approach in Old Fig Garden: we design for the shade, not despite it. That means microinverters or DC optimizers on nearly every job, honest production modeling that accounts for those daily shade windows, and battery sizing that reflects what your roof can genuinely generate in December, not just what it can generate in July.

Our Solar Battery Storage & Backup Services in Old Fig Garden

Tesla Powerwall Installation

The Powerwall 3 is the most common battery we install in Old Fig Garden, and for good reason. Its integrated inverter simplifies the retrofit on older homes, and its 11.5 kW output can start most central air conditioners without a soft-start device. On the shaded roofs common around Van Ness Boulevard and Palm Avenue, the Powerwall 3 pairs well with panel-level optimization, which we recommend on nearly every 93704 install. A single Powerwall 3 in Old Fig Garden typically runs $11,000-$15,500 installed, before any applicable tax credit.

Enphase IQ Battery Installation

The Enphase IQ Battery is a strong match for homes that already run Enphase microinverters, which describes a growing share of the older solar arrays we see in Old Fig Garden. The modular design allows sizing from 5 kWh up to 40 kWh in 5 kWh increments, which suits the wide range of system sizes across this neighborhood. The Enphase system also handles partial-shade conditions well, an advantage in a place where every mature oak and fig tree is a moving shadow for six hours a day. Expect a typical IQ Battery install in Old Fig Garden to land between $9,500 and $14,000 depending on the number of 5 kWh units specified.

Whole-Home Backup Power

Whole-home backup in Old Fig Garden usually means backing up a 3,000-5,000 square foot home built between 1925 and 1955, often with multiple HVAC zones, a pool pump, and a well. That requires careful load management and honest capacity planning. Most whole-home setups in 93704 use two to three batteries and a smart essential-loads panel, because trying to run everything at once from a single battery is a recipe for a shutdown on the first hot August afternoon. We specify the battery bank to the actual circuits you need, not a generic square-footage formula.

Battery Retrofit for Existing Solar

This is the most common request we hear in Old Fig Garden: “We already have panels, can we add a battery?” The answer is usually yes, with two caveats. First, your existing inverter has to be compatible with the battery you choose, and on older systems from the early 2010s, that sometimes means replacing the inverter as part of the job. Second, if your home still has the original 100-amp service panel, that must be upgraded before the battery can pass final inspection. We handle both pieces as one project, with one permit and one point of contact. A retrofit on a 2015-era solar array in Old Fig Garden typically runs $10,000-$16,000, including the panel upgrade when needed.

Common Solar Battery Storage & Backup Problems We See in Old Fig Garden Homes

  • Original 100-amp panels that can’t pass inspection. Many Old Fig Garden homes still have their original service panels, and a battery install will not clear final sign-off until that panel is upgraded to 200 amps. We flag this in the quote, so it’s not a surprise at inspection day.
  • Tule fog weeks that starve the battery. December and January bring dense valley fog that can cut panel output by 50-70% for days at a time. A battery sized only for summer loads will be dead at night during those fog stretches. We model winter production honestly so you know what the battery can genuinely do when the sun disappears for a week.
  • Shade from mature trees dragging down the whole array. Without panel-level optimization, one fig branch across one panel can pull down an entire string. We default to microinverters or DC optimizers in Old Fig Garden, because the tree canopy is part of the permanent reality of this neighborhood.
  • Rear-slope-only installations that underproduce. On architecturally prominent properties along streets like Van Ness, there’s often pressure to hide panels from the street. We get it. But an east- or north-facing rear array may only generate 65% of what a properly oriented array would produce. When that’s the chosen route, we size the battery bank accordingly and tell you the honest numbers before you sign.

Pricing for Solar Battery Storage & Backup in Old Fig Garden, CA

Here’s what you should expect to pay in Old Fig Garden as of 2026. A single-battery retrofit on an existing compatible solar system runs $9,500-$12,000. A Tesla Powerwall 3 with a new service panel upgrade lands between $11,000 and $15,500. A two-battery whole-home setup with load management typically comes in at $16,000-$22,000. A FranklinWH aPower system, which excels at whole-home backup on older properties, generally runs $14,000-$20,000 installed. These are the numbers we quote, and they’re the numbers on the invoice.
